The ideal memory test for thermal intermittence is typically the "Temperature Cycling Test." This test evaluates how a device or component performs under varying temperature conditions, simulating real-world thermal fluctuations. It helps identify potential failures or performance degradation due to thermal stress, ensuring reliability in applications where temperature changes are common. Additionally, the test can be complemented by other assessments like thermal shock testing for comprehensive evaluation.
